Michael MacDonald, a resident of an Edinburgh flat for 12 years, has been enduring a seven-month ordeal due to a malfunctioning lift, forcing him to climb seven flights of stairs daily. Despite paying a £160 monthly fee to Lowther Homes for maintenance, the lift remains out of service.

A Scots joiner has told of his disbelief after his flat's lift has been left out of use for seven months.

They claim they never received the schematic designs for the lift and issues with the elevator's age have meant repairing the issue has been extremely problematic, time consuming and costly. “But it has been seven months now and if the company they went to could not figure it out then they should have got someone else in to fix it. They have not given me any indication as to when it will be fixed.”
